About These Formats
WebM is technically a subset of the Matroska container family that powers MKV, but it is purposefully constrained to royalty-free codecs (VP8 or VP9 video, Vorbis or Opus audio) so it can be played in any browser without licensing risk. That makes the convert MKV to WebM step the right move when you want to publish footage from a media library on the open web, embed a clip in a help center article, or stream a short film from your own domain without paying for a video host. The conversion almost always re-encodes the video, because MKV typically carries H.264 or HEVC and WebM requires VP9 or AV1; the upside is a meaningfully smaller file at the same perceived quality, often 30% lighter than an equivalent MP4. You will also need to choose a single audio track and drop embedded subtitles, since browsers expect a much simpler structure than MKV exposes. For 1080p web playback, target 4 to 5 Mbps VP9 with 128 kbps Opus audio for the cleanest result.

Common Issues
- infoWebM is a strict subset of MKV — only one video track, one audio track, and no embedded SRT or ASS subtitles fit.
- infoMultiple audio tracks (dubs, commentary) must be dropped — pick one before exporting or each will be lost silently.
- infoSoft subtitles do not survive — burn them into the video stream first if they are required for accessibility.
- infoHEVC sources are re-encoded to VP9, which can introduce banding in dark scenes at lower target bitrates.
